Copolymerization of ethylene oxide and carbon dioxide

Abstract
The present disclosure is directed, in part, to methods of synthesizing a poly(ethylene carbonate) polymer from the reaction of ethylene oxide (EO) and carbon dioxide (CO 2 ) in the presence of a metal complex. The present disclosure also provides novel metal complexes. In one aspect, the metal complex is of the formula (I), wherein R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, M, X and Ring A are as defined herein.
